What's The Definition Of Spinel?
spinel in American English
a variously colored, crystalline mineral, MgAlO4, used as a gem; magnesium aluminum oxide noun: any of a group of minerals composed principally of oxides of magnesium, aluminum, iron, manganese, chromium, etc., characterized by their hardness and octahedral crystals spinel in British English noun: any of a group of hard glassy minerals of variable colour consisting of oxides of aluminium, magnesium, chromium, iron, zinc, or manganese and occurring in the form of octahedral crystals: used as gemstones |
